Serve as the primary receptionist for the Department of State Legal Office and provide clerical and office support within the Department of State Legal Office to ensure its operations are conducted efficiently and effectively. |

Act as the main receptionist by answering phones and directing callers. Screen phone calls for office staff including answering of routine questions and referring calls to various department staff and other agencies. Direct individuals to appropriate personnel. Provide information or resolve any problems as it relates to office personnel’s availability. Use discretion, independent judgement and tact to when divulging information to callers, as legal matters are often confidential in nature. Employee must adapt in a rapidly changing environment by keeping up to date on all Counsel Division and Legal Office rules and procedures. This includes retention of both written and verbally communicated changes and to maintain updated procedural notes and reference tools. Maintains and updates the reception desk references and manual in the hard copy reference binder and digital files. Maintains a working knowledge of related agencies and processes in order to assist and direct callers within the Legal Office, as well as elsewhere within Department of State. Maintains working knowledge of reception scripts and F.A.Q. responses in the Reception Manual and updates manual as needed. Operate office equipment such as a personal computer (with Microsoft Windows 10 and Office365 suite), photocopier, scanner, facsimile machine and shredder. Assist attorneys on how to operate equipment by providing basic technical support. Keep all office equipment clean, in stock (toner, paper, staples, etc.), and operational (i.e. clear paper jams, reset errors, report issues requiring service calls). Entering data into the agency case management system, including, logging case related mail, uploading documents, processing payments, and tracking activities and license status changes. Open, sort, date stamp, log and scan incoming legal office mail. Identify urgent items that require direct attention of attorneys or attorneys’ legal assistants and notify appropriate staff. Identify and separate mail items for processing by legal assistants and provide appropriate notifications. Draft routine correspondence and memos for employee’s own signature or attorneys’ signatures regarding case filings, outstanding penalties, press releases and paid legal notices, and other case related matters, which requires knowledge and understanding of the specific legal case. Proofread outgoing correspondence, orders and court documents to ensure that information is grammatically correct, formatted correctly and adheres to all agency, court and Office of General Counsel requirements. Electronically file and distribute orders utilizing agency case management system. Name files using established digital file naming rules and save to network drives in attorneys’ reader folders and other folders as required. Create, maintain and review Counsel Division case files requiring a working knowledge of current procedures and case progression. Prepare final documents(s)/order(s) for mailing. Use knowledge of mailing procedures for first class and certified mail. Assist attorneys in recovering information, such as prior office decisions, opinions, and procedures to ensure consistency in the operation of the Legal Office. Locate and acquire information for attorneys from various publications. Use the Internet and law library resources to obtain copies of cases, statutes, and regulations for attorneys. Act as backup to Counsel Division legal assistants as needed and perform other general duties as assigned or requested by a supervisor. |

Duties and responsibilities are performed with considerable independence requiring minimal direct supervision. Assignments are received both verbally and in writing; employee must decide how to organize, prioritize and complete assignments to meet deadlines. Employee applies discretion and judgment when dispensing information, referring and directing callers and visitors. Sorting, organizing and reviewing incoming mail to determine the appropriate recipient in order to log and track all case related items in the case database. Employee must decide appropriate formats to use when typing correspondence, reports and court documents. Periodic review and consultations are conducted with the supervisor to ensure the goals of the Legal Office are met. |
